At the forefront of this digital revolution in perfumery is Robertet's NaturIA. It is a specialised tool that elevates the creation of fragrances by analysing and optimising combinations from the company’s extensive ingredient portfolio.
NaturIA serves as a creative ally to perfumers, maintaining artistic individuality while enhancing the overall scent creation process. This synergy ensures a deeper emotional connection with fragrances, highlighting the role of AI not only as a solution but also as a partner in olfactory artistry.
Mapping emotion through scent
Understanding emotional responses to scents has always been a priority in creating truly impactful fragrances. Robertet’s patented Seed to Feel methodology, complemented by virtual reality, employs AI to link physiological reactions to specific aromas. This advanced approach allows for an accurate assessment of emotional signatures associated with different fragrances, fostering more personalised and innovative perfume development. By mapping these intricate connections, AI enables scent creation that resonates deeply with consumers on an emotional level.
Superior anti-odour technology
Innovation in the fragrance domain isn’t restricted to aesthetic appeal alone. Robertet’s Neutral Plus®, developed with the help of AI, exemplifies cutting-edge research in anti-odour technology. These patented solutions address odour concerns across various sectors, including household, personal care, and industrial applications. The ability to incorporate AI-driven mechanisms allows for more effective and efficient olfactory solutions, enhancing user experiences across multiple product categories.
Beauty enriched with AI
The potential of AI in fragrances extends to multi-functional benefits, as demonstrated by Robertet’s ActiScent fragrances. These innovations marry the aesthetic allure of scents with cosmetic advantages, leveraging AI to evaluate efficacy and optimise results. Such dual-purpose products signify a noteworthy advancement in fragrance development with the promise of sensory pleasure and practical benefits.
